Safety Precautions to Take When Dealing with Plumbing Emergencies
When plumbing emergencies occur, it’s essential to prioritize safety to avoid injury or further damage. Taking the right precautions can make a significant difference in preventing accidents and ensuring a quick resolution to the issue.
When dealing with a burst pipe in a flooded room, it’s crucial to prevent electrical shocks. This can be achieved by avoiding electrical outlets and switches, and unplugging any appliances that may be affected by the water. To further minimize risks, you should wear safety equipment such as rubber gloves and waterproof boots.
Protecting Against Electrical Shocks
To prevent electrical shocks, follow these steps:
- Switch off the power at the main electrical panel or circuit breaker. This will prevent any electrical current from flowing through the water.
- Unplug any appliances that may be affected by the water to avoid short circuits.
- Avoid standing in water or touching any electrical outlets or switches.
- Use rubber gloves and waterproof boots to prevent electrical shock.
- Keep children and pets away from the affected area.

Shutting Off the Water Supply
In the event of a plumbing emergency, shutting off the water supply is crucial to prevent further damage and minimize risks.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to do it safely:
- Locate the main shut-off valve, usually found near the water meter or where the water line enters your home.
- To shut off the water supply to the affected area, turn the shut-off valve clockwise. This will prevent any further water flow to the affected area.
- If you can’t find the main shut-off valve, you may need to shut off the water supply to your entire home. To do this, locate the main water shut-off valve usually located near the water meter and turn it clockwise.
- Once the water supply is shut off, inspect the affected area for any further damage and take necessary measures to prevent water from flowing back into the area.
- Turn the shut-off valve counterclockwise to restore water supply once the emergency has been resolved.
